THRIFTY OIL CO:,1_ 11" <br /> October 18, 1994 1" r- <br /> Mr Mike Infurna <br /> Public Health Services/Environmental Health Division <br /> County of San Joaquin <br /> P O Box 2009 (1601 E Hazelton Ave ) <br /> Stockton, California 95201 <br /> RE- 7hrjfty Oil Company Station #172 <br /> 7647 Pacific Avenue <br /> Stockton, CA 95207 <br /> Quarterly Monitoring Report <br /> 3rd Quarter 19945 4v,>( <br /> Dear Mr Infurna <br /> This letter serves as a quarterly monitoring report for the above mentioned service station This <br /> status report presents site monitoring efforts during the 3rd quarter, 1994 Thrifty Oil Co has <br /> retained Earth Management Co (EMC) to conduct quarterly monitoring and sampling activities <br /> at the site The data is reported by Thrifty's in-house environmental staff <br /> SITE REMEDIATION <br /> To date, remediation of soil and groundwater has not been conducted at the site As requested <br /> by PHS/EHD, a revised workplan for additional investigation at the site with regard to definition <br /> of the vertical and lateral extent of soil and groundwater contamination was submitted by Thrifty <br /> Oil Co In April 1994, this work was completed, it included installation of new wells MW7 and <br /> MW8, and presented recommendations for additional site work Thrifty's Site Assessment <br /> Report dated June 13, 1994 contains details regarding this investigation <br /> GROUNDWATER MONITORING <br /> On August 15, 1994, the site was visited by an Earth Management Co (EMC) technician The <br /> EMC technician obtained depth to groundwater data and observed wells for the presence of free <br /> product Groundwater depth measurements were taken from the top of PVC well casing using <br /> an Oil Recovery Systems interface probe capable of measurements to within 0 01 feet. Depth <br /> to groundwater ranged from 50 06 to 51 37 feet below grade which is a drop of about 2 5 feet <br /> from the last reported data Using the depth,to groundwater and survey data for the site, a <br /> groundwater contour map was developed The contour map is presented as Figure 1 The <br /> contour map suggests that the potentiometric surface of the shallow groundwater is generally flat <br /> across the site with a slight eastward trend. The hydraulic gradient is about 0 0006 This data <br /> is consistent with last quarter's interpretation <br /> V <br /> 10000 Lakewood Boulevard, Downey, CA 90240-4082 9 (310) 923-9876 <br />
